Announcement: "Moonshot" Apollo Anniversary Party at The Ark
The Ark is celebrating the 50th anniversary of the Apollo Moon landing with eight hours of music, including DJ Tantari with her new "Walking on the Moon" set.
DJ Books - 12 pm - 2 pm
DJ Xiao - 2 - 4 pm
DJ Tantari - 4 - 6 pm
DJ Cranky Rabbit - 6 - 8 pm

DJ Tantari Honors the SL Newser
DJ Tantari Kim, noted for her high-energy performance, has honored the Newser in the past, such as her playful "True Facts" ribbing of yours truly for our fifth anniversary. Not long ago, she did a music track in honor of the newsletter: Newser, "Dedicated to Bixyl. News is what somebody somewhere wants to suppress. All the rest is advertising." She had tried new things with the track, which played at the Happy Vixen's "Workin' for a Living" party. But she thought it needed improvement, and on Sunday August 13 came up with Newser 2 , "If I tell you a secret, will you promise to keep it keep it close to your heart and never tell a soul?" Well, some things do remain off the record. She played the song at The Ark to an approving audience.
DJ Tantari plays at the Happy Vixen every Tuesday night at 6PM SL time. Rock on Tantari.

The Ark
If you're one of Second Life's longtime furred residents, chances are you've heard of "The Ark." Owned and run by Shadowquine Maltz, this club high above the Quarabia sim has been running for about a decade. If you're looking to socialize, you're sure to find a crowd there as the place runs most if not all of the day and night. But as it's an adult-themed club with nude girls on dancepoles, and with the crowds come lag that can slow down some residents, the place is not for everyone. But despite the lag, people come, "People just like The Ark."
